China Achieves First Successful Landing of Reusable Rocket
China has successfully landed a reusable rocket for the first time, a significant technological milestone. This achievement suggests that China is poised to challenge the United States' current dominance in the field of reusable rocket technology. The successful landing marks a critical step forward in China's space exploration and commercial spaceflight ambitions. It demonstrates advanced capabilities in rocket recovery and refurbishment, which are essential for reducing launch costs and increasing launch frequency. This development is likely to accelerate competition in the global space market, potentially leading to new innovations and more accessible space missions. The success is a clear indicator of China's growing prowess in aerospace engineering and its strategic investment in space capabilities.
